Ticket #— Floor 9 Opening Prep, Brindlemoor House

Hi facilities folks, Floor 9 opens to staff next Monday and we need a few things squared away before then. Lift access is live, but the two side doors by the kitchenette are still on the old lock config — please reprogram them before Friday. Also, signage for the quiet rooms hasn't arrived, so pop up the temporary printed ones for now. Until the badge readers sync, the interim door code for Floor 9 is below.

door code, bajop-bajog: bdg-DSWAC-43621

Handover — Clueforge generator

Picking this up from me means owning the daily puzzle build. It runs at 03:00, writes grids to the publish bucket, and flags any fill failures to the support queue. If a customer reports a missing puzzle, rerun the build job manually; it's safe to repeat. The service starts with the configuration listed here.

deployment values, fafog-fawip:
[jorox]
team = fendor
access_code = ac_bb00ea
host = jorox.qorveltech.internal
port = 9200
owner = istdor.aldeth
peer = julvan.orvexlabs.internal

Offline mode — Fernwick Survey app. Field crews in low-coverage regions run the Fernwick client with OFFLINE_MODE=1, which queues survey submissions to local storage and syncs when connectivity returns. Maintainers should also set SYNC_BATCH_SIZE=50 and OFFLINE_TTL_HOURS=72 to bound queue growth. The sync worker encrypts queued payloads at rest, and the encryption key is read from the env file on the line that follows.

env line for fawip-fajef: COURIER_KEY13=6b302cb20dc80

### Item 9 — String extraction script

Before cutting a release, run the Lexigrab extraction script against the Fernvale app and make sure the output matches what's committed — stray diffs usually mean someone hand-edited the locale files again. Check that placeholder tokens survived extraction intact. If anything looks off, don't guess; raise it with the script's owner named below.

approver of yajef-fajef = Oliwyn Silion Kasok Kasox

## Service Accounts — StormFan Alert Fan-Out

The fan-out worker authenticates to the internal dispatch tier using the svc-stormfan account. Rotate quarterly; scopes are limited to publish-only on alert topics. If deliveries stall during your shift, verify the worker is using the current credential, reproduced below for reference.

API key for kaweg-hahif: kto4_rAjZ